Hello,
I'm trying to fill the area between these two curves:

I had tried to use fill and patch function to shade but I didnt make it...

Any idea on how to fix the problem?
Thank you in advance for your help!

My best guess for what's happening (since I don't have your variables and I don't have Simulink) is that the variables are column vectors, so that fliplr and horizontal concatenation is not an appropriate mathod for using the variables for patch vertices.
First, I try to reproduce the problem:
% I don't have Simulink, so I make a struct
% 'out' similar to yours (my best guess):
out = struct( ...
'va1',(25:50).', ...
'va2',(25:50).', ...
'L1',linspace(-5,25,26).', ...
'L2',0.1*(25:50).'.^2-3*(25:50).'+16.6);
% plot the lines the same way you do:
plot(out.va1,out.L1);
hold on;
plot(out.va2,out.L2);
% create the patches like you do:
patch([out.va1, fliplr(out.va1)],[out.L1,fliplr(out.L2)],'r');
X=[out.va1,fliplr(out.va1)];
Y=[out.L1,fliplr(out.L2)];
fill(X,Y,'b');
Now, I try to fix the problem (if my guess is correct):
figure();
% plot the lines the same way:
plot(out.va1,out.L1);
hold on;
plot(out.va2,out.L2);
% create a patch using flipud and vertical concatentation:
patch([out.va1; flipud(out.va1)],[out.L1; flipud(out.L2)],'b');
